About Qualicum School District

Qualicum School District is centrally situated on east Vancouver Island and covers the area of Nanoose Bay to Bowser and spans from Errington across the Strait of Georgia to Lasqueti Island. We serve a student population of approximately 4700 students. Qualicum School District consists of eight elementary schools (Grades K7 two secondary schools (Grade 812 an alternate school (PASS/Woodwinds) and a Distributed Learning program to support homelearning families called the Collaborative Education Alternative Program (CEAP). False Bay School on Lasqueti Island is entirely offgrid with an immense solar project recently completed. Qualicum School District also embraces many community organizations through various school programs. The areas natural beauty neverending beaches mild climate and smalltown charm make it a popular tourist destination and a great opportunity to have a career in paradise.

Assignment: Area Counsellor (At this time the initial assignment is to Kwalikum Secondary School)

  • Counselling secondary students

The assignment may change due to the itinerant nature of the position or to meet the needs of the schools educational program grade organization and/or enrollment.

1.00 FTE TEMPORARY

Commencing as soon as possible until an undetermined date or upon notification that the temporary position will end earlier due to budgetary issues or declining enrollment.

The successful candidate will be expected to:

  • Support school staff members in working with students who demonstrate educational behavioural social and/or emotional needs;

  • Develop Individual Education Plans (IEPs) for designated Intensive and Moderate Behaviour students and assist staff members in implementing and monitoring these plans;

  • Provide social skills training to students as required;

  • Work in consultation with Case Managers in the development and implementation of Individual Education Plans for students who require additional support;

  • Serve as a member of the schools Critical Incident Response Team and act as liaison to the districts Critical Incident Response Team;

  • Serve as a member of the Schoolbased Team;

  • Complete and submit monthly and yearend reports/summaries as required;

  • Work collaboratively with parents staff administration community groups and outside agencies in support of students;

  • Deliver Graduation Transitions to the grade 12 cohort;

  • Work within the established district and community agency referral processes;

  • Attend monthly Student Support Services staff meetings when appropriate;

  • Attend monthly meetings of counsellors;

  • Support the work of the school toward achievement of growth plan goals;

  • Integrate use of Information and Communication Technology (ICT) to support teaching and learning manage information and carryout professional communication.

The successful candidate will have the following qualifications:

  • A valid BC Teaching Certificate and familiarity with the BC curriculum at the secondary level;

  • A Masters degree in counselling;

  • Experience meeting the diverse educational behavioural social and emotional needs of students and their families in a secondary school setting counselling environment;

  • Experience developing and implementing effective strategies to assist teachers and parents in working with students who present with behaviour issues;
  • Experience working in student timetabling transcript verifications program scheduling (preferably MyEducationBC);

  • Experience transitioning students from elementary to high school and from high school to postsecondary (knowledge of college/university programs application processes).
